Heard the learned Counsel for the applicant.
This is an application filed by the original Respondent in Criminal Appeal No. 840 of 2017. On 20/9/2017 application seeking leave to appeal was allowed by the Hon'ble Justice A.M. Badar. The Court had issued notice to the respondent and Clause-v of the operative order reads as follows :
"In the meanwhile, action under Section 390 of the Code of Criminal Procedure to follow before the learned trial Court." The learned Counsel for the applicant submits that since the court has directed an action under section 390 of the Code of Criminal Procedure, 1973, it is presumed that a non-bailable warrant is issued against the respondent.
As contemplated under section 390 of the Code of Criminal Procedure, 1973, the respondent shall appear before the first court i.e. Metropolitan Magistrate, 72 nd Court, Vikhroli, Mumbai and 2/3
execute bail bond as contemplated under section 390 of the Code of Criminal Procedure, 1973 on or before 9/2/2018. Execution of the non-bailable warrant is stayed upto 9/2/2018. The application is allowed and disposed of accordingly. (SMT. SADHANA S. JADHAV,J) 3/3
